Clinical and Academic Research

Accelerate your studies and clinical workflows by automating mobility assessments. Built with industry-specific, validated machine learning models, trained on proprietary datasets through NIH-funded research, PathML is ready for research and care, supporting activities of daily living (ADLs) and functional clinical outcome assessments.

Remote Patient Monitoring

PathML can be used to enhance post-surgery recovery and chronic disease management. Easy setup also enables PathML to supplement efforts in facilitating at-home care for aging seniors. Able to be used with most existing cameras, PathML provides facial blurring to ensure privacy and integrates into existing patient monitoring systems.

Workforce Safety

Rapidly identify high-risk, repetitive movements that can lead to debilitating musculoskeletal disorders requiring expensive worker compensation. PathML offers a new approach to workplace safety, automating ergonomic and movement risk assessments using clinically grounded computer vision models.
